- tranquilization - correct answer️️a state of tranquility and calmness in which the animal is awake, relaxed, and unconcerned about its surroundings. The animal is easily arousable and will respond to painful stimuli. 
 
sedation - correct answer️️more profound central nervous system depression than tranquilization in which the animal is awake, sleepy, but still able to be aroused by stimulation. Minor manipulations can be performed, and aggressive animals may be easier to handle.

anesthesia - loss of sensation to part/entire body to depress the activity of nervous tissue locally/regionally/within CNS 
 
 general anesthesia - drug induced unconsciousness that is characterized by controlled but reversible depression of CNS 
 
 anesthesiologist - a person with a doctoral degree who has been certified by the ACVAA/ECVAA and legally qualified to administer anesthetics/related techniques
